Output becc852a0588631ec2a4498b80cf05a39ae8795870ed6951f030e26f17a17627:2

value
1998793170
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bfcb373143573de93bcce92bc726c47925c1acfa OP_EQUAL
address
3KB8RrHEXaboiXTEhnTfv9VWGa7xsXJqSr
transaction
becc852a0588631ec2a4498b80cf05a39ae8795870ed6951f030e26f17a17627
confirmations
395265
spent
true